Coronavirus: Wallingford pub bans under 25s for flouting virus measures | Coronavirus: Wallingford pub bans under 25s for flouting virus measures |
(30 minutes later) | |
A pub in Oxfordshire has banned under 25s in the evenings after some drinkers refused to adhere to its coronavirus social distancing measures. | A pub in Oxfordshire has banned under 25s in the evenings after some drinkers refused to adhere to its coronavirus social distancing measures. |
The Royal Standard in Wallingford said since it reopened younger drinkers had been "impossible to control" putting staff and other customers at risk. | The Royal Standard in Wallingford said since it reopened younger drinkers had been "impossible to control" putting staff and other customers at risk. |
Landlord David Haines said: "They start off fine but then it goes out the window." | Landlord David Haines said: "They start off fine but then it goes out the window." |
Under 25s will only be allowed in the pub before 20:00 BST. | Under 25s will only be allowed in the pub before 20:00 BST. |
Mr Haines said an "unprecedented number" of younger drinkers had been attracted to the pub since it reopened on Saturday who were "refusing to adhere to any social distancing rules". | Mr Haines said an "unprecedented number" of younger drinkers had been attracted to the pub since it reopened on Saturday who were "refusing to adhere to any social distancing rules". |
He said: "In spite of how many times you ask them to sit in groups of six it goes out the window - it was impossible to control. | He said: "In spite of how many times you ask them to sit in groups of six it goes out the window - it was impossible to control. |
"We've got a greater duty to our customers and our staff. We apologise to those of you who are affected and we will review this decision periodically." | "We've got a greater duty to our customers and our staff. We apologise to those of you who are affected and we will review this decision periodically." |
The pub said its measures included temperature checks, contact tracing, a one-way system around the building, tables set at least one metre apart and table service only. | |
Hundreds of pubs and venues welcomed customers on Saturday after three months as lockdown measures were eased. | Hundreds of pubs and venues welcomed customers on Saturday after three months as lockdown measures were eased. |
At least three establishments announced they had shut their doors again just days after reopening at the weekend after customers tested positive for coronavirus. | At least three establishments announced they had shut their doors again just days after reopening at the weekend after customers tested positive for coronavirus. |
